IONIAN ISLANDS, Septinsular Republic. Under Russian-Ottoman supremacy. 1800-1807. 5 Gazzettai 1801 (Copper, 32.5 mm, 21.75 g, 12 h), Corfu, denomination in Italian, edged with a chain-pattern. ✱ΕΠΤΑΝΗΣΟΣ ΠΟΛΙΤΕΙΑ The winged lion of Saint Mark holding Book of Gospels surmounted by 7 arrows representing the 7 Ionian islands. Rev. -5- / GΑΖZΕΤE / ✱1081✱ in three lines, with the date engraved retrograde; the whole within round chain border. Karamitsos I.4a. Lambros 6 (same dies and possibly this coin depicted!). KM 3. Graded by NGC "AU 58 BN". Top pop in pop report both companies. Cert number: 2909008-006.

KINGS OF MACEDON. Antigonos II Gonatas, 277/6-239 BC. Tetradrachm (Silver, 31 mm, 17.09 g, 5 h), Amphipolis, circa 274/1-260/55. Horned head of Pan to left, wearing goat's skin tied around his neck and with lagobolon behind; all within the center of a Macedonian shield adorned with seven stars within double crescents. Rev. BAΣIΛEΩΣ ANTIΓONOΥ Athena Alkidemos striding to left, hurling thunderbolt with her upraised right hand and holding shield with her left; in field to left, Macedonian helmet with transverse crest; in field to right, EPM monogram. Meydancikkale 2588. Panagopoulou Period III. Toned. Very fine.
